Absolutely bone chilling audio has been released of a young 7 year old girl begging her grandmother not to take her to her mothers house just days before tragic death!

Within the absolutely devastating audio you can hear little Julissa Batties crying and saying, “Grandma, call the police! I don’t want to go with mommy”.

In another audio recording the grandmother Yolanda Davis asked the child what could the police do Julissa responded in sayin, “Help me out”.


Unfortunately, the child went to visit her mom through a court ordered weekend visit to her mother Navasia Jones. According to the New York Post, Yolanda was Julissa’s foster parent and her mother had lost custody of her at birth along with her 4 sons due to negligence and abuse.

However on June 21st, 2021 the city Administration for Children’s Services allowed Julissa to return to live with her mother, for the very first time without supervision. Sadly, later than two months on August 10th she was announced dead.

Reports read that Navasia states Julissa had fell and hit her head on a desk, but her 17 year old son states that he punched Julissia eight times in her face and that hours later, she started throwing up and passed out.

Navasia had called 911, and Julissa was rushed to the hospital with brutal injuries, but sadly the young girl could not be saved.

A medical examiner ruled Julissa’s death a homicide but states the blows weren’t the cause of her death. The incident occurred almost 10 months ago and no one has been arrested yet as the NYPD is still investigating.
